What is the difference between Entry Level Python Data Analysis vs Data Analyst?

AspectEntry Level Python Data AnalysisData Analyst
Required SkillsPython, SQL, basic statistics, data visualizationExcel, SQL, statistics, data visualization
CertificationsPython programming, data analysis coursesExcel, Tableau, SQL certifications
Work EnvironmentTech companies, startups, data-driven teamsBusiness, finance, healthcare sectors
Typical TasksData cleaning, scripting in Python, creating dashboardsData reporting, analysis, presenting insights

Entry Level Python Data Analysis focuses on using Python for data manipulation and visualization, often requiring programming skills. Data Analysts may use a broader set of tools like Excel and Tableau but also perform similar data interpretation tasks. Both roles are entry-level positions in data teams, but Python skills give an edge in automation and handling larger datasets.

Role Overview
The Gas Turbine Performance Engineer I provides entry-level engineering support for evaluating and improving gas turbine thermal performance. This role supports performance analysis, field testing, combustion system studies, and fluid system design while developing foundational skills in gas turbine engineering. Working under guidance of senior engineers, the position contributes to meeting contractual performance obligations and supporting business development initiatives through data analysis, testing, and technical reporting.
Key Responsibilities
  • Support evaluation of gas turbine thermal performance including power output, heat rate, pressures, temperatures, and component efficiencies using engineering principles.
  • Assist in analyzing remote monitoring data to evaluate performance, availability, and reliability and identify improvement opportunities.
  • Perform basic diagnostic analysis of operational data to support identification of performance losses.
  • Support detailed compressor and turbine performance analysis under guidance of senior engineers.
  • Assist in development of thermal performance testing procedures aligned with ASME or ISO standards.
  • Participate in field performance testing, including data collection, validation, and reporting.
  • Support combustion system and fuel utilization studies, including emissions analysis and troubleshooting activities.
  • Assist in fluid system design and analysis including P&ID interpretation, component selection, and system evaluation.
  • Prepare technical documentation, reports, and presentations for internal and external stakeholders.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support engineering and operational objectives.

Requirements
  • Bachelor of Science in Mechanical or Aerospace Engineering with emphasis on thermal fluids from an accredited institution.
  • 0-3 years of experience in gas turbine engineering, performance analysis, or related field (including internships or co-ops).
  • Basic understanding of thermodynamics, fluid mechanics, and gas turbine performance principles.
  • Exposure to data analysis, engineering calculations, and technical problem solving.
  • Familiarity with engineering software, modeling tools, or programming languages is a plus.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
  • Ability to learn quickly and work collaboratively in a team environment.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office tools.
  • Ability to travel up to 20% as required.
